Global FDI capex declines by a third in 2012

Lacklustre economic growth in Europe, Japan and Brazil, much slower growth in China, political instability in the Middle East, and policy uncertainty in the US all negatively impacted the global FDI market in 2012, resulting in a significant decline in crossborder flows.
